Minor vehicle collision with possible minor injury at intersection, Harrisburg NC
Heads up: This post was detected from real-time dispatch audio. Information may be incomplete, and the situation may evolve. Always verify using official agency releases.
Two vehicles collided with minor damage at the intersection near University City Boulevard and Founders Way. One person reported a possible minor injury. Emergency medical response was downgraded to a routine level.
